kolab-util-calendar: unset the CamelURL port for HTTP requests
* the port number we read from CamelKolabIMAPXSettings is the
configured IMAP port
* this does not make sense for HTTP, so we just unset the port
number and rely on the HTTP/HTTPS protocol type for port
selection
* this has the limitation that we presently cannot configure
an explicit port number for HTTP(S) requests (e.g. to use
some HTTP proxy)
